Everyone says that AIs are better than humans now and that they will take all of our jobs and kill us all (maybe), so let’s actually test that theory with real money on the line. I’ve funded 4 Fidelity accounts with $100 each. One account for me, one for ChatGPT, one for Claude, and one for Gemini. Let’s see who makes the most money by year end.
Rules:
- Everyone needs to pick 5 different stocks, no ETFs allowed
- You can’t pick stocks that have already been chosen by others
- $20 will be allocated to each stock that is picked, if the stock price is higher than $20, $20 worth of fractional shares of that stock will be bought
The Stock Draft
I used a randomizer to decide the order of everyone’s stock picking. The result is 1. Me 2. Claude 3. Gemini 4. ChatGPT (definitely not rigged)
Round 1:
- Vinson: Alphabet (NASDAQ: GOOG)
- Claude: NVIDIA (NASDAQ: NVDA)
- Gemini: Microsoft (NASDAQ: MSFT)
- ChatGPT: Eli Lilly (NYSE: LLY)
Round 2:
- Vinson: Taiwan Semiconductor Manufacturing Co. (NYSE: TSM)
- Claude: Amazon (NASDAQ: AMZN)
- Gemini: Visa (NYSE: V)
- ChatGPT: ASML (NASDAQ: ASML)
Round 3:
- Vinson: Berkshire Hathaway (NYSE: BERK.B)
- Claude: Meta (NASDAQ: META)
- Gemini: Broadcom (NASDAQ: AVGO)
- ChatGPT: Apple (NASDAQ: AAPL)
Round 4:
- Vinson: Charles Schwab (NYSE: SCHW)
- Claude: Palantir (NASDAQ: PLTR)
- Gemini: Novo Nordisk (NYSE: NVO)
- ChatGPT: Costco Wholesale (NASDAQ: COST)
Round 5:
- Vinson: American Express (NYSE: AXP)
- Claude: Coinbase (NASDAQ: COIN)
- Gemini: Netflix (NASDAQ: NFLX)
- ChatGPT: JPMorgan Chase (NYSE: JPM)

Claude:
I went all in on the AI stack (NVDA/AMZN/META/PLTR) plus COIN as a volatility play—absolutely gambling compared to everyone else's blue-chip portfolios, but in a 5-stock yearly competition I'm swinging for upside not playing it safe. Vinson built the most balanced portfolio with GOOG/TSM/BRK.B, though SCHW+AXP feels redundant. Gemini's got the boring compounder playbook (MSFT/V/AVGO), ChatGPT diversified smartly but conservatively (LLY/ASML/AAPL). Let's see if my concentrated tech bet pays off or blows up spectacularly.
Gemini:
I’ll wear the "boring" badge with pride—my portfolio (MSFT, V, AVGO, NVO, NFLX) is the only one capturing five distinct megatrends (Cloud, Payments, Chips, GLP-1s, Streaming) without taking on Claude’s insane crypto-casino risk or Vinson’s dangerous overexposure to financials. While Vinson is banking heavily on interest rates with three bank/finance picks and ChatGPT played it safe with "mom and pop" stocks like Costco, I’ve simply locked in the undisputed king of every major growth sector. It’s not flashy; it’s just designed to win.
ChatGPT:
I leaned into high-quality compounders with different economic drivers—healthcare (LLY), semiconductor infrastructure (ASML), consumer tech (AAPL), retail (COST), and banking (JPM)—basically a “don’t blow up, keep compounding” portfolio. It’s intentionally less volatile than Claude’s AI-casino approach and less macro-sensitive than Vinson’s finance-heavy lineup, but still has real growth levers through AI demand, buybacks, and pricing power. I may not win in a melt-up driven by memes or crypto beta, but if this year rewards consistency, margins, and balance sheets, this portfolio is built to quietly grind out a very competitive return.
